FOUNDATIONS
The
Foundation of The University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Inc. and The Athletic Foundationof
The University of North Carolina at Charlotte are two chartered bodies specifically establishedand
authorized to accept gifts from private sources for the benefit of the University.
Please see Policy
Statement #28 – Solicitation and Acceptance of Gifts
The
Office of The Foundation and Other Entities administer funds received through
these twoFoundations whose
common purpose it is to further the educational goals of The University ofNorth
Carolina at Charlotte. The staff is
responsible for the maintenance and performance allall
accounting and tax functions for these two independent corporate entities. Each corporation isorganized
under Chapter 55A of the General Statues of North Carolina and is a tax-exemptorganization
under Section 501(c)(3) of the Internal Revenue Code.
Therefore, gifts or contributionsto
either entity meeting the requirements of the Internal Revenue Code under Section
170 willqualify as a tax deductible
contribution.
OTHER ENTITIES
The
Office of The Foundation and Other Entities staff also perform the accounting
and tax functionsfor University Research Park, Incorporated which was organized to foster and stimulate
the physical,economic and social
growth and development of Charlotte and Mecklenburg County to benefit itscitizens. The staff also offers accounting support to
The Ben Craig Center, Inc. which was organizedto
develop the entrepreneurial potential of Charlotte and Mecklenburg County by developing a favorable
environment for the formation of new businesses.
These efforts undertaken to developthe
growth of Charlotte and Mecklenburg County are extremely important factors to the local community
from which the University seeks
its students and therefore, greatly benefits the University.
